Back Door Installation Cost: A Comprehensive Guide

The installation of a back door is a significant home enhancement project that can improve a residential or commercial property’s functionality, visual appeals, and security. However, understanding the expenses included in this endeavor is crucial for homeowners to prepare their spending plans efficiently. This article provides an in-depth look at back entrance installation costs, elements affecting costs, and approximates to assist homeowners make informed decisions.

Aspects Influencing Back Door Installation Costs

Before property owners dive into the installation process, numerous elements require to be considered that can affect the total cost. Below are the essential aspects that contribute to the variation in installation expenses:

1. Kind of Door

The type of back entrance selected will considerably affect the installation cost. Doors are available in numerous materials, styles, and sizes. Common types consist of:

  • Standard Hinged Doors: Usually the most affordable option.
  • Moving Doors: Offers ease of access and tends to be costlier.
  • French Doors: These can include beauty but generally come at a higher cost.
  • Security Doors: Typically more expensive due to included features.

2. Product

The product of the door plays an essential function in prices. Alternatives include:

  • Wood: Offers natural appeal but can be costly and needs regular maintenance.
  • Fiberglass: A popular option for durability and energy performance, though it can range in price.
  • Steel: Provides outstanding security and insulation however might be heavier and harder to install.

3. Labor Costs

Labor expenses can substantially affect the overall installation price. Charges may vary depending on geographical location, the intricacy of the job, and the professional’s experience. Typically, labor expenses can v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 per hour.

4. Existing Framework

If the existing door frame is in good shape, expenses will be lower as less preparation is needed. If there are issues like rot or a need for resizing the opening, additional expenditures can be incurred.

5. Extra Features

Homeowners may want to include functions such as:

  • Glass panels
  • Custom creates
  • High-security locks
  • Weather condition stripping or insulation

These extra features will usually increase the cost of the installation.

6. Licenses and Inspections

In some areas, property owners might require permits for door setups, particularly if structural changes are included. This might add 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 to the overall costs.

Average Installation Costs

While expenses can differ extensively based on the factors pointed out above, homeowners can anticipate to pay a large range for back door installation. Here’s a breakdown of typical expenses:

Type of Door Average Cost (Material Only) Average Installation Cost Overall Average Cost
Requirement Hinged Door ₤ 200 – ₤ 600 ₤ 300 – ₤ 800 ₤ 500 – ₤ 1,400
Sliding Door ₤ 400 – ₤ 1,200 ₤ 400 – ₤ 1,000 ₤ 800 – ₤ 2,200
French Doors ₤ 1,000 – ₤ 4,000 ₤ 400 – ₤ 1,200 ₤ 1,400 – ₤ 5,200
Security Door ₤ 300 – ₤ 1,500 ₤ 300 – ₤ 1,200 ₤ 600 – ₤ 2,700

(Note: These figures represent estimates and can vary based upon regional trends and specific situations.)

Tips for Reducing Back Door Installation Costs

House owners wanting to save money on back entrance installation can consider the following ideas:

  1. Get Multiple Quotes: Obtain estimates from several contractors to compare costs and services.
  2. Choose Standard Sizes: Custom doors can considerably increase costs; basic sizes are frequently more affordable.
  3. Do it yourself Preparation: If comfortable with it, property owners can remove the old door themselves to save on labor costs.
  4. Purchase Off-Season: Consider shopping throughout off-peak seasons for much better deals and sales.

Frequently Asked Questions About Back Door Installation Costs

1. The length of time does it require to set up a back door?

Installation normally takes between two to four hours, depending on the intricacy of the job and the type of door being installed.

2. Can I install a back entrance myself?

While property owners can attempt a DIY installation, it needs some carpentry abilities. It is often recommended to hire a professional for correct measurements and fit to ensure security and performance.

3. Do I need a license for back door installation?

Permits might be needed depending on local structure codes, specifically if structural modifications are involved. It’s recommended to consult local authorities.

4. What is the very best type of back entrance for energy efficiency?

Fiberglass doors tend to rank high for energy efficiency, followed by insulated steel doors. They assist in keeping a constant indoor temperature.

5. Are there any warranties readily available for back entrances?

Lots of makers use warranties on the doors themselves. Furthermore, professional installers might likewise offer assurances for their work. Constantly ask about warranties when purchasing a door.
